Newly revised and updated with new stories, and in a larger format The second edition of this massive omnibus volume (600+ pages ) collects all of Van Allen Plexico's short and medium-length pulp fiction published between 2006-2017, plus excerpts from two novels. Sherlock Holmes, Kerry Keen: the Griffon, Hawk, the Sentinels, Lucian, the Monster Aces, the Danger People, Mars McCoy, John Blackthorn, Gideon Cain: Demon Hunter and more great heroes and villains populate the pages of this huge tome. Now includes the out-of-print novella "Cold Lightning" as well as other stories not available in the first edition. With an Introduction by pulp legend Ron Fortier. Author Biography
Van Allen Plexico has won numerous New Pulp and Pulp Factory awards including Best Novel (twice). He is the author of 15 novels and many novellas and short stories, all of which are included in this book. An associate professor by day, he's best known as the author of the long-running Sentinels superhero novel series and the Shattering space opera series. He lives in southern Illinois.
